1. Start with the site you actually need to operate
The relevant question for a Pepperell-serving firm is not whether dedicated infrastructure sounds attractive. It is whether your present hosting arrangement supports the website you use today and the changes you expect to make. Review the current host, site platform, database, media library, forms, redirects, DNS records, SSL certificate and any third-party services before discussing a move.
